|
| 1 | +# -*- coding: utf-8 -*- |
| 2 | +import datetime |
| 3 | +from south.db import db |
| 4 | +from south.v2 import SchemaMigration |
| 5 | +from django.db import models |
| 6 | + |
| 7 | + |
| 8 | +class Migration(SchemaMigration): |
| 9 | + |
| 10 | + def forwards(self, orm): |
| 11 | + # Changing field 'Branch.name' |
| 12 | + db.alter_column('codespeed_branch', 'name', self.gf('django.db.models.fields.CharField')(max_length=50)) |
| 13 | + |
| 14 | + def backwards(self, orm): |
| 15 | + # Changing field 'Branch.name' |
| 16 | + db.alter_column('codespeed_branch', 'name', self.gf('django.db.models.fields.CharField')(max_length=20)) |
| 17 | + |
| 18 | + models = { |
| 19 | + 'codespeed.benchmark': { |
| 20 | + 'Meta': {'object_name': 'Benchmark'}, |
| 21 | + 'benchmark_type': ('django.db.models.fields.CharField', [], {'default': "'C'", 'max_length': '1'}), |
| 22 | + 'description': ('django.db.models.fields.CharField', [], {'max_length': '300', 'blank': 'True'}), |
| 23 | + 'id': ('django.db.models.fields.AutoField', [], {'primary_key': 'True'}), |
| 24 | + 'lessisbetter': ('django.db.models.fields.BooleanField', [], {'default': 'True'}), |
| 25 | + 'name': ('django.db.models.fields.CharField', [], {'unique': 'True', 'max_length': '30'}), |
| 26 | + 'units': ('django.db.models.fields.CharField', [], {'default': "'seconds'", 'max_length': '20'}), |
| 27 | + 'units_title': ('django.db.models.fields.CharField', [], {'default': "'Time'", 'max_length': '30'}) |
| 28 | + }, |
| 29 | + 'codespeed.branch': { |
| 30 | + 'Meta': {'unique_together': "(('name', 'project'),)", 'object_name': 'Branch'}, |
| 31 | + 'id': ('django.db.models.fields.AutoField', [], {'primary_key': 'True'}), |
| 32 | + 'name': ('django.db.models.fields.CharField', [], {'max_length': '50'}), |
| 33 | + 'project':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'branches'", 'to': "orm['codespeed.Project']"}) |
| 34 | + }, |
| 35 | + 'codespeed.environment': { |
| 36 | + 'Meta': {'object_name': 'Environment'}, |
| 37 | + 'cpu': ('django.db.models.fields.CharField', [], {'max_length': '30', 'blank': 'True'}), |
| 38 | + 'id': ('django.db.models.fields.AutoField', [], {'primary_key': 'True'}), |
| 39 | + 'kernel': ('django.db.models.fields.CharField', [], {'max_length': '30', 'blank': 'True'}), |
| 40 | + 'memory': ('django.db.models.fields.CharField', [], {'max_length': '30', 'blank': 'True'}), |
| 41 | + 'name': ('django.db.models.fields.CharField', [], {'unique': 'True', 'max_length': '30'}), |
| 42 | + 'os': ('django.db.models.fields.CharField', [], {'max_length': '30', 'blank': 'True'}) |
| 43 | + }, |
| 44 | + 'codespeed.executable': { |
| 45 | + 'Meta': {'object_name': 'Executable'}, |
| 46 | + 'description': ('django.db.models.fields.CharField', [], {'max_length': '200', 'blank': 'True'}), |
| 47 | + 'id': ('django.db.models.fields.AutoField', [], {'primary_key': 'True'}), |
| 48 | + 'name': ('django.db.models.fields.CharField', [], {'unique': 'True', 'max_length': '30'}), |
| 49 | + 'project':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'executables'", 'to': "orm['codespeed.Project']"}) |
| 50 | + }, |
| 51 | + 'codespeed.project': { |
| 52 | + 'Meta': {'object_name': 'Project'}, |
| 53 | + 'id': ('django.db.models.fields.AutoField', [], {'primary_key': 'True'}), |
| 54 | + 'name': ('django.db.models.fields.CharField', [], {'unique': 'True', 'max_length': '30'}), |
| 55 | + 'repo_pass': ('django.db.models.fields.CharField', [], {'max_length': '100', 'blank': 'True'}), |
| 56 | + 'repo_path': ('django.db.models.fields.CharField', [], {'max_length': '200', 'blank': 'True'}), |
| 57 | + 'repo_type': ('django.db.models.fields.CharField', [], {'default': "'N'", 'max_length': '1'}), |
| 58 | + 'repo_user': ('django.db.models.fields.CharField', [], {'max_length': '100', 'blank': 'True'}), |
| 59 | + 'track': ('django.db.models.fields.BooleanField', [], {'default': 'False'}) |
| 60 | + }, |
| 61 | + 'codespeed.report': { |
| 62 | + 'Meta': {'unique_together': "(('revision', 'executable', 'environment'),)", 'object_name': 'Report'}, |
| 63 | + '_tablecache': ('django.db.models.fields.TextField', [], {'blank': 'True'}), |
| 64 | + 'colorcode': ('django.db.models.fields.CharField', [], {'default': "'none'", 'max_length': '10'}), |
| 65 | + 'environment':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'reports'", 'to': "orm['codespeed.Environment']"}), |
| 66 | + 'executable':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'reports'", 'to': "orm['codespeed.Executable']"}), |
| 67 | + 'id': ('django.db.models.fields.AutoField', [], {'primary_key': 'True'}), |
| 68 | + 'revision':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'reports'", 'to': "orm['codespeed.Revision']"}), |
| 69 | + 'summary': ('django.db.models.fields.CharField', [], {'max_length': '64', 'blank': 'True'}) |
| 70 | + }, |
| 71 | + 'codespeed.result': { |
| 72 | + 'Meta': {'unique_together': "(('revision', 'executable', 'benchmark', 'environment'),)", 'object_name': 'Result'}, |
| 73 | + 'benchmark':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'results'", 'to': "orm['codespeed.Benchmark']"}), |
| 74 | + 'date': ('django.db.models.fields.DateTimeField', [], {'null': 'True', 'blank': 'True'}), |
| 75 | + 'environment':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'results'", 'to': "orm['codespeed.Environment']"}), |
| 76 | + 'executable':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'results'", 'to': "orm['codespeed.Executable']"}), |
| 77 | + 'id': ('django.db.models.fields.AutoField', [], {'primary_key': 'True'}), |
| 78 | + 'revision':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'results'", 'to': "orm['codespeed.Revision']"}), |
| 79 | + 'std_dev': ('django.db.models.fields.FloatField', [], {'null': 'True', 'blank': 'True'}), |
| 80 | + 'val_max': ('django.db.models.fields.FloatField', [], {'null': 'True', 'blank': 'True'}), |
| 81 | + 'val_min': ('django.db.models.fields.FloatField', [], {'null': 'True', 'blank': 'True'}), |
| 82 | + 'value': ('django.db.models.fields.FloatField', [], {}) |
| 83 | + }, |
| 84 | + 'codespeed.revision': { |
| 85 | + 'Meta': {'unique_together': "(('commitid', 'branch'),)", 'object_name': 'Revision'}, |
| 86 | + 'author': ('django.db.models.fields.CharField', [], {'max_length': '30', 'blank': 'True'}), |
| 87 | + 'branch': ('django.db.models.fields.related.ForeignKey', [], {'related_name': "'revisions'", 'to': "orm['codespeed.Branch']"}), |
| 88 | + 'commitid': ('django.db.models.fields.CharField', [], {'max_length': '42'}), |
| 89 | + 'date': ('django.db.models.fields.DateTimeField', [], {'null': 'True'}), |
| 90 | + 'id': ('django.db.models.fields.AutoField', [], {'primary_key': 'True'}), |
| 91 | + 'message': ('django.db.models.fields.TextField', [], {'blank': 'True'}), |
| 92 | + 'project': ('django.db.models.fields.related.ForeignKey', [], {'blank': 'True', 'related_name': "'revisions'", 'null': 'True', 'to': "orm['codespeed.Project']"}), |
| 93 | + 'tag': ('django.db.models.fields.CharField', [], {'max_length': '20', 'blank': 'True'}) |
| 94 | + } |
| 95 | + } |
| 96 | + |
| 97 | + complete_apps = ['codespeed'] |
0 commit comments